Ordinals
beta
Sat 854218077864867
decimal
170843.3077864867
degree
0°170843′1499″3077864867‴
percentile
40.6770513716432%
name
hukoywmuaeo
cycle
0
epoch
0
period
84
block
170843
offset
3077864867
timestamp
2012-03-12 15:22:16 UTC
rarity
common
prev
next